Welcome one and all to the exclusive 13th Annual Rich Wives-Con!  Your hosts, Andy Known and Countess Lulu are thrilled to have all of you joining them as we gather to celebrate the reality show 'Rich Wives'!

However, this year, a dark cloud hangs over the festivities like a...well... dark cloud.  A Rich Wife, being honored for her contribution to the show, comes to a fateful end.  Who could do such a thing to such a person on such a night?!  You'll have to attend to find out!

With your purchase, you get an excellent dinner prepared and served by the Library Restaurant & Pub. Please don't hesitate to let us know if you have special dietary needs. The Library Chef is ready to assist you. 

After Act I, you will receive your choice of the soup of the day or salad plus bread. 

After Act II comes your choice between these delicious entrees. 

Penne Pasta Primavera – Spinach, artichoke hearts, mushrooms, and tomato relish sautéed with basil pesto, olive oil, garlic, parmesan cheese, and penne pasta.

Chicken Marsala – Lightly breaded chicken breasts smothered in our house-made Marsala mushroom wine sauce, topped with a sprinkle of parmesan cheese, and served with rice pilaf.

Maple Bourbon Pork Chop: This thick, bone-in chop is brushed with a house-made maple bourbon glaze and served with a baked potato.

Baked Walleye: A Flakey walleye filet is baked with seasoned bread crumbs and drizzled with a lemon Chablis butter sauce. It is served with rice pilaf.

The Library Restaurant's specialty is steak, so you have to have that as a choice! Ribeye: Twelve ounces of beautifully marbled steak served with a baked potato.

After Act III, a delectable plate of cheesecake comes out as you prepare your guess at Who Dunnit. Hmm, boy! 

With your ticket, you also get the show, the game, interaction with the rest of the audience, and the antics of our funny performers.

The drinks with the ticket are coffee, tea, or soft drinks with free refills.

Your gratuity for your server is taken care of as part of the ticket price. 

Some things are outside your ticket.

Extra are bar drinks and a gratuity for your server’s drink service. The Library Restaurant has a full bar to serve you.

We've opened the room early so you can arrive and enjoy some appetizers. They're also extra.

You will get a separate bill for the bar and appetizers at the end of the evening.
